Skip to main content
added 185 characters in body
Source Link
m_callens
  • 909
  • 2
  • 8

In Solana, your wallet has an address and then can have N many associated token accounts that also have their own unique addresses that are derived from the combination of the parent wallet's address and the address of the token mint.

You're able to send an SPL token to the parent wallet address and the token program is smart enough to deposit the token into the correct associated token account, however, each of them still have their own unique address.


EDIT

(b) would be correct in your updated example. Each asset have its own associated token account with its own address that is owned by the parental Solana wallet (which also has its own address).

In order for the smart routing that i described to work (sending SPL tokens to the parent wallet), the underlying associated token accounts must already exist for that token mint.

In Solana, your wallet has an address and then can have N many associated token accounts that also have their own unique addresses that are derived from the combination of the parent wallet's address and the address of the token mint.

You're able to send an SPL token to the parent wallet address and the token program is smart enough to deposit the token into the correct associated token account, however, each of them still have their own unique address.

In Solana, your wallet has an address and then can have N many associated token accounts that also have their own unique addresses that are derived from the combination of the parent wallet's address and the address of the token mint.

You're able to send an SPL token to the parent wallet address and the token program is smart enough to deposit the token into the correct associated token account, however, each of them still have their own unique address.


EDIT

(b) would be correct in your updated example. Each asset have its own associated token account with its own address that is owned by the parental Solana wallet (which also has its own address).

In order for the smart routing that i described to work (sending SPL tokens to the parent wallet), the underlying associated token accounts must already exist for that token mint.

Source Link
m_callens
  • 909
  • 2
  • 8

In Solana, your wallet has an address and then can have N many associated token accounts that also have their own unique addresses that are derived from the combination of the parent wallet's address and the address of the token mint.

You're able to send an SPL token to the parent wallet address and the token program is smart enough to deposit the token into the correct associated token account, however, each of them still have their own unique address.